Al trabajo en bicicleta

By TuBoston.com

El viernes 22 de agosto alístate a pedalear tu bicicleta hasta el City Hall Plaza. Se trata del "Bike Friday", un día en el que grupos de ciclistas podrán formar un "convoy" que será escoltado por la Policía de Boston. Los convoys tienen rutas específicas y partirán desde diferentes puntos en Boston. Regístrate ya en www.cityofboston.gov/bikes

Auspiciado por City of Boston, Mass Commute, Mass Bike, LivableStreets Alliance, WZLX y Green Streets Initiative.

WHAT: SAFE, GUIDED CONVOYS WITH POLICE ESCORT Lead by experienced cyclists and escorted by Boston Police, convoys follow a fixed schedule and route and originate at locations throughout metro-Boston. All convoys finish at City Hall Plaza Boston.

FREE BREAKFAST, BIKE EXPO AND MUSIC Whether you ride in with a convoy or ride along, join us at Boston City Hall for free food and fun, courtesy of 100.7 WZLX, Mass Commute, Mass Bike, and all our sponsors.

SCHEDULE:
6:45 AM Meet at convoy start. See locations below. 
7:00 AM Convoys depart. See locations below. 
7:30-8:30 AM Convoys arrive City Hall Plz, Boston. 
8:00-10:00 AM Free breakfast & fun. City Hall Plz, Boston.

WHERE: Rides start from various locations in metro-Boston. Cyclists can join the convoy at start location, or at any point along the route. See map for locations and times. Police escorts only available within Boston.
